Q: How easy is access within a stage? Between stages?
A: Well, that's a sticky wicket. Headwaters
is not a ProRally, so we don't make the same allowances for
spectators. We can't publish the routes ahead of time so
we can't say where we will be running. You can pretty much
count on "the crossroads" being used, but I can't say much
more than that.
We give our workers the best maps and
directions. Stage captains lead our workers into the woods,
and sweep will lead the way back. If you are not working,
you can ask at the worker registration desk and they will
very likely give you a map and some basic directions.
